Manchester United’s Assessment of Carlos Baleba Amid Brighton Showdown

Anticipation for Today’s Match

Manchester United is set to take on Brighton & Hove Albion today, maintaining a perspective that Carlos Baleba does not currently justify a £100 million price tag. As the Seagulls make their way to Old Trafford for this Premier League encounter, United recognizes Baleba as a valuable potential addition to their squad.

Interest in Baleba

The Red Devils are eager to observe Baleba’s performance at the iconic stadium, demonstrating continued appreciation for his skills. However, there are lingering uncertainties regarding his actual market value.

Previously, Manchester United made inquiries about transferring Baleba last summer, aware that securing a deal would be challenging. Their intent was clear: to communicate to both Baleba and Brighton that their interest was serious.

Brighton’s Stance on Baleba

Brighton has consistently communicated that Baleba is not available for transfer and refrained from providing a specific price. Reports at that time indicated that he was valued at over £100 million. Presently, it appears Brighton maintains a high valuation of the midfielder, leading insiders at United to doubt their willingness to meet such a price.

For any potential transfer to materialize in January, there would need to be a reconsideration of Baleba’s price, or the United hierarchy would have to be thoroughly convinced of his worth.

A standout performance from Baleba in today’s match could potentially shift perceptions regarding his value.

Evaluating Baleba’s Performance

Baleba, who is only 21 years old, aligns well with the playing style of Ruben Amorim, but United is cautious of making an excessive financial commitment. It is evident they are exploring additional options, and skepticism is growing regarding the likelihood of a deal for Baleba being reached in January.

While Baleba had a remarkable season with Brighton in 2024/25, his form has not replicated that success during the current season. He has yet to complete a full 90 minutes, and his performances have not met the standards set in the previous campaign.

Brighton, however, remains optimistic that he is on the verge of regaining his top form and views him as a crucial asset for the remainder of the season.

Conclusion

Ultimately, Brighton has no interest in negotiating a sale for Baleba at this time, making it seem likely that he will remain with the club. Meanwhile, Manchester United will continue evaluating other potential targets in the transfer market.
